The Friends Of St Margaret's Church, Wellow

Also known as: St Margaret's Wellow Appeal Fund

The Charity was established by a Governing Instrument and Rules on 13 January 1981. The object is the upkeep, maintenance and repair of the Parish Church of St Margaret's Wellow, together with the whole of its curtilage, present and future, including the churchyard, church rooms and car parking, with its connections as the burial place of Florence Nightingale.
